Nov. 12, 2012

AMHERST, Mass. - After Saturday's performance in the win at Akron, UMass football punter Colter Johnson has been named the MAC Special Team Player of the Week as announced by the league office on Monday. Johnson averaged 44.8 yards per boot with four of his six punts being downed inside the 10-yard line. Twice in the second half, he pinned Akron back to their one-yard line.

Johnson becomes the first Minuteman to earn a MAC weekly honor. The Minutemen defeated Akron 22-14 for the program's first-ever win at the FBS level and as members of the Mid-American Conference.

On Saturday, Johnson also had a long punt of 53 yards. Of his two punts that were not downed within the 10 yard line, one came in the second quarter with the ball at the UMass two-yard line and Johnson booting the ball 45 yards out of the end zone. The second was in the final two minutes of the fourth quarter as he punted the ball 49-yards to pin Akron at their own 22-yard line for what proved their final possession of the game.

Through 10 games, Johnson ranks 2nd in punting average (43.5 yards) in the MAC - just 0.1 yards behind league leader Jay Karutz of Eastern Michigan. His 16 punts of 50+ yards is good for second most in the league as well.
